fre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

《程序設(shè)計(jì)綜合課程設(shè)計(jì)》報(bào)告-圖書館管理系統(tǒng)-預(yù)覽頁

2024-10-09 17:53 上一頁面

下一頁面
 

【正文】 ,則可以繼續(xù)操作 !繼續(xù)輸入更改后的書名、作者。 //定義變量存放刪除修改書籍的作者 Book book。 cout書號(hào) 。 cout作者 。 cout借閱人 \n。 cinnamer。 程序設(shè)計(jì)綜合課程設(shè)計(jì) 9 輸 入 要 修改 的 讀 者姓 名該 讀 者 是 否 存 在確 認(rèn) 是 否 修 改輸 入 Y / y操 作 取 消修 改 成 功輸 入 更 改 后 的讀 者 的 姓 名 、班 級(jí) 、 電 話存在不存在是否對(duì) 不 起 , 系 統(tǒng) 無該 記 錄 , 重 輸 請(qǐng)按 1 , 返 回 請(qǐng) 按 036修改讀者流程圖 刪除讀者函數(shù) 刪除讀者用戶函數(shù)包括輸入要?jiǎng)h除的讀者用戶的姓名,若用戶姓名存在則顯示 是否真的刪除該記錄 (y/n),否則顯示對(duì)不起 ,系統(tǒng)尚無該讀者記錄 ! 輸 入 要 刪除 的 讀 者姓 名該 讀 者 是 否 存 在確 認(rèn) 是 否 刪 除輸 入 Y / y操 作 取 消刪 除 成 功存在不存在是否對(duì) 不 起 , 系 統(tǒng) 無該 讀 者 記 錄37刪除讀者流程圖 登錄函數(shù) 登陸包 括讀者登陸和管理員登陸。調(diào)用讀者結(jié)構(gòu)體設(shè)置讀者姓名函數(shù),讀者結(jié)構(gòu)體設(shè)置讀者班級(jí)函數(shù),讀者結(jié)構(gòu)體設(shè)置聯(lián)系電話函數(shù),讀者結(jié)構(gòu)體添加讀者函數(shù)來實(shí)現(xiàn)。 //調(diào)用讀者結(jié)構(gòu)體設(shè)置聯(lián)系電話函數(shù) add_reader(reader)。還書則輸入讀者姓名,判斷讀者是否注冊,已注冊則還書成功,否則先注冊。 ReaderManage reader。 //需要還書的書號(hào) char dz[10]。 系統(tǒng)雖然完成了,也可以運(yùn)行,一些基本的功能也能夠?qū)崿F(xiàn),但我知道,還有很多的不足。 在今后的學(xué)習(xí)和實(shí)踐中我會(huì)繼續(xù)加強(qiáng)對(duì) C 語言程序的操作使用、維護(hù)以及調(diào)試,通過此次實(shí)例 的設(shè)計(jì),培養(yǎng)了自己在設(shè)計(jì)程序時(shí)一定的思維方式和思考能力,提高了自己對(duì) C 語言程序設(shè)計(jì)的理解能力,達(dá)到了此次 C 語言程序設(shè)計(jì)課程目的和要求。 char rclass[10]。strcpy(rtel,)。} char *get_rclass() //獲得班級(jí) {return rclass。strcpy(rclass,())。 //定義讀者結(jié)構(gòu)體數(shù)組對(duì)象 ,最多 50 位 int length。exit(1)。readers[i],sizeof(Reader))))//計(jì)算并返回所占字節(jié)數(shù) i++。 //定義輸出文件流對(duì)象 fwrite if(!fwrite) {cout文件保存失敗 !\n。//計(jì)算并返回所占字節(jié)數(shù) ()。return 。ilength。 //調(diào)用讀者結(jié)構(gòu)體 cpoy 函數(shù) return true。 //用后面的地址覆蓋前面的地址 length。 return false。 //電話 tel Reader reader。 cinc。 //調(diào)用讀者結(jié)構(gòu)體設(shè)置讀者姓名函數(shù) (c)。 } void show_reader() //不帶參的顯示讀者信息函數(shù) { cout\n **********************讀 ****者 ****信 ****息 ****列 ****表 **********************\n\n。i++) { coutreaders[i].get_rname()。 cout姓名 \t\t\t班級(jí) \t\t\t電話 \n。 } }。 //作者 char rname[10]。strcpy(bauthor,)。} //把字符串 no 中的字符復(fù)制到字符串bnum 中 char *get_bnum() //獲得書號(hào) { return bnum。} char * get_bauthor() //獲得作者姓名 {return bauthor。} void show_tag() //顯示圖書狀態(tài) { if(tag==1) {cout已借 。 strcpy(bauthor,())。 //定義 Book 書籍結(jié)構(gòu)體數(shù)組對(duì)象 ,最大容量 100本 int length。 } 程序設(shè)計(jì)綜合課程設(shè)計(jì) 25 (BookFile,ios::binary)。 //定義輸入文件流對(duì)象 fread length=0。 //定義書籍結(jié)構(gòu)體臨時(shí)對(duì)象 temp int i=0。 //每讀完一次 ,指針后移一位 ,直到不能讀出正確結(jié)果為止 length=i。 //調(diào)用讀取文件函數(shù) } ~BookManage() //析構(gòu)函數(shù) ,保存磁盤文件 { 程序設(shè)計(jì)綜合課程設(shè)計(jì) 26 saveFile()。 //調(diào)用書籍結(jié)構(gòu)體 copy 函數(shù) length++。i++) if(strcmp(books[i].get_bnum(),bnu)==0) //字符串比較 ,判斷是否相等 return i。i++) if(strcmp(books[i].get_bname(),bna)==0) //判斷 return i。i++) if(strcmp(books[i].get_bauthor(),bau)==0)//判斷 return i。i++) if(strcmp(books[i].get_rname(),rn)==0)//判斷 return i。ilength1。 cout書號(hào) 。 cout作者 。 cout借閱人 \n。 (10)。 (10)。 } } void show_book(int i)//帶參的顯示書籍函數(shù) { cout **********************書 ****籍 ****信 ****息 ****列 ****表**********************\n\n。 (20)。 程序設(shè)計(jì)綜合課程設(shè)計(jì) 29 (10)。 coutbooks[i].get_bname()。 books[i].show_tag()。 int choi。 //讀者姓名 cinsh。 switch(a) { case 1: 程序設(shè)計(jì)綜合課程設(shè)計(jì) 30 cout\n\t該書目前狀態(tài)為 已借出 \n。 //清除以回車結(jié)束的輸入緩沖區(qū)的內(nèi)容 ,消除上一次輸入對(duì)下一次輸入的影響 if(choi!=1amp。 } else if(choi==1) { cout\n\t 請(qǐng)輸入您的姓名: 。 if(index1==1) { cout\n\t 對(duì)不起 ,系統(tǒng)無該讀者記錄 ,新用戶請(qǐng)先注冊 !。//借閱人一項(xiàng)變?yōu)榭瞻? books[index].set_tag(0)。 cout\n\t請(qǐng)您需要的服務(wù): 1:借書 0:返回 \n。amp。 cindz。 } else { books[index].set_rname(dz)。 } } 程序設(shè)計(jì)綜合課程設(shè)計(jì) 32 else { cout\n\t對(duì)不起 ,系統(tǒng)無該書記錄 !。 //**********菜單結(jié) 構(gòu)體 ,實(shí)現(xiàn)界面引導(dǎo) ********** class Menu { BookManage bm。 //菜單序號(hào)選擇 int key。 程序設(shè)計(jì)綜合課程設(shè)計(jì) 33 cout\t ※ ※ \n。 cout\t ※※※※※※※※※※※※※※※※※※※※※※※※※※※※ \n。 cout\n\t\t\t\t1: 管理員 \n\n\t\t\t\t2: 讀 者 \n\n\t\t\t\t0: 退 出 \n\t您的選擇是: 。 //管理員登錄 ,需密碼驗(yàn)證 break。 //退出系統(tǒng) break。 //system(color f9)。 cout\t ※ ※ \n。 cout\t ※ ※ \n。 cout\t ※ ※ \n。 cout\t ※※※※※※※※※※※※※※※※※※※※※※※※※※※※ \n。 switch(choice) { case 1: //添加圖書 addBook()。 bm.~BookManage()。 break。 cout\n\t顯示完畢 !。 case 6: //修改讀者 reviseReader()。 rm.~ReaderManage()。 system(pause)。 log_menu()。 goto choice。 cout\t ※ ※ \n。 cout\t ※ ※ \n。 cout\t ※ ※ \n。 choice: cinchoice。 bm.~BookManage()。 bm.~BookManage()。 case 4: rn_search()。 break。 goto choice。 cout\t\t\t※ ※ \n。 cout\t\t\t※ ※ \n。 cout\t\t\t※ ※ \n。 cout\t\t\t※ ※ \n。 cinbsc。 case 2: bna_search()。 case 4: reader_menu()。 break。 cout\t\t\t※ ※ \n。 cout\t\t\t※ ※ \n。 cout\t\t\t※ ※ \n。 cout\t\t\t※ ※ \n。 cinbsc。 case 2: bna_search()。 case 4: admin_men
點(diǎn)擊復(fù)制文檔內(nèi)容
公司管理相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1